Description
This is the back of a 1972 Topps Chris Farasopoulos card #36. The 1972 Topps design features a dual-color border on the reverse with biographical information, a 'Kickoff Return Record' table, and a small cartoon illustration. This specific card represents Farasopoulos during his tenure as a Safety and Kickoff Returner for the New York Jets.

Selling Tips
As a common player in mid-to-low grade, this card is not worth the cost of professional grading. It is best sold to a New York Jets team collector or someone attempting to complete the 1972 Topps master set. Use a non-machinable envelope to save on shipping costs for low-value items.
